This time the #2 linebacker on the team http://www.810whb.com/article/4445# Missouri linebacker arrested for DWI Missouri linebacker Will Ebner was arrested Sunday morning on suspicion of driving while intoxicated. The junior middle linebacker was stopped by officers from the Boone County Sheriff’s Department, taken into custody at 2:15 a.m. and released on $500 bond. Ebner, 20, has been recovering from a hamstring injury through most of preseason camp. He was Missouri’s third-leading tackler last season with 78 stops and began the preseason as the Tigers’ No. 2 middle linebacker, behind co-captain Luke Lambert. The DWI arrest is the second to strike Missouri's football program this month. On Aug. 2, offensive line coach Bruce Walker was arrested outside the team facility on suspicion of operating his vehicle while intoxicated. Walker is still waiting to be officially charged by the city prosecutor. He's due in court for arraignment on Sept. 13, a city official said last week. Stay tuned for more on Ebner’s status. |
